Why people recommend it
Small Spaces by Katherine Arden is a middle-grade horror fantasy novel that follows a young girl who encounters a sinister mystery involving a spooky local farm and scarecrows. On the episode The Sunday Special: The Books We Read in School from the podcast The Book Review, aired on October 3, 2025, Gilbert Cruz recommended the title. Cruz identified the book as an ideal selection for readers who are slightly older, noting that it serves as the opening installment in a series written by Katherine Arden.
